When transporting a mobility scooter with a vehicle, it's crucial to ensure that it's secure. Straps or bungees may be used to secure the scooter. You can also protect your scooter from damage by putting a blanket over the floor of the trunk.

A ramp is a great method to place your scooter inside the boot of your car. There are many choices which is why you should choose one that best meets your needs.

The Aerolight Lifestyle ramp folds that can be laid out and then put away, while the Ultralight Telescopic ramp is a full-width version that lets you lift it up as you need for loading your scooter into your car. Ramps are a good solution, but they're also quite heavy and require permanent modifications to your vehicle or van that may negatively impact the value of your vehicle.

It is also possible to use a vehicle that is wheelchair accessible or a hoist to provide an ongoing solution. They are specifically designed to assist people to move their scooters into the back of their car. In contrast to ramps, which typically require fixing to the structure of the van or car hoists are powered and can lift far larger scooters into the back of the car.

The i3 folding scooter is a fantastic example of car boot scooters, it folds up to an extremely compact size and operates using a single lithium-based battery. It has a travel range of 7 miles or more and can be expanded by adding a spare battery.

Detachable scooters are another popular option, they can be reassembled and stored easily in a bag to be used for transportation or storage. They are a little heavier than their folding counterparts but the ease of assembly makes them more practical for those who want to take them with them on excursions.
